Brian Damage
When Kane made is WWF debut on October 5, 1997, he quickly became the most feared superstar on the roster. ‘The Big Red Monster’ was one of the most successful masked wrestlers in WWE history. His feud with his “brother” the Undertaker was classic. He was also the first masked wrestler to win the WWF title. After six years of donning a mask, it was time for a change.

On June 23, 2003 at Madison Square Garden, Kane challenged Triple H for the World Heavyweight title. If Kane lost the match, however, he would be forced to remove his mask. Triple H did indeed win the contest and Kane was obligated to unmask for the very first time. After he removed his mask and revealed his face…Kane went berserk and attacked everyone in sight…including his then tag team partner Rob Van Dam.

At the time, Vince McMahon was wondering how he could freshen up the Kane character. McMahon started to feel that he was becoming stale. Glenn Jacobs also started to feel trapped wearing the mask. He said that he couldn’t fully utilize his facial expressions during promos and matches and that was a very important part of the wrestling business. According to Bruce Prichard, McMahon said…“What if we unmask him?” Vince then left it up to Prichard to come up with a new look and vision for the character. Prichard said he let his warped mind take over and began coming up with various concepts.

The main thing Bruce Prichard wanted to achieve was continue the theme that Kane was a burn survivor and that half his body was still scarred from being burned alive as a child. Glenn Jacobs had naturally grown his own hair long for the character. Prichard wanted to cut most of it off, leaving patches of his real hair on different spots on his head. The gimmick was that Kane wore a wig this entire time. It was Prichard, who cut Jacobs hair giving him his new look.

While Jacobs was certainly beginning to look the part of a monster, there was one person who wasn’t a fan of the “new” look Kane. That person, was Glenn’s wife Crystal, who absolutely hated it. Glenn Jacobs, himself wasn’t crazy about looking like that outside of a WWE ring. He and Prichard came to a compromise, he would do the unmasking spot looking like he did, but after it was done, he would be allowed to shave his head bald to at least appear semi normal while home with his family.

Jacobs still wasn’t completely thrilled with his altered look, but was better than originally planned. The new look Kane became more evil and sadistic and it ultimately worked.
